The Autobots are not simply "the good guys" against the evil Decepticons. Their history is far more complex, rooted in millions of years of Cybertronian civilization, social castes, revolutions, and sacrifices. To truly understand this faction, one must go back to the very origins of Cybertron.
Primus, the 13 Primes, and the birth of a faction
According to the deepest official lore — notably the War for Cybertron trilogy and Transformers One — the planet Cybertron itself is a living being: Primus, the creator god opposed to Unicron, the cosmic destroyer. The first Transformers, the original 13 Primes, were forged directly by Primus to guard the Matrix of Leadership and protect the universe. It is from this lineage that the Autobot philosophy directly stems: to protect life in all its forms, at any cost. Iacon, fortress city and cradle of resistance
On Cybertron, the Autobots are historically linked to the city of Iacon — their main stronghold, opposite Kaon, the Decepticons' stronghold. It was there that Optimus Prime established his headquarters, there that the Iacon Archives and the Allspark archives are located. When the Great War made Cybertron uninhabitable, Iacon became the symbol of everything the Autobots were fighting to preserve. Why the Autobots arrived on Earth
Earth was not a chosen destination — it was a necessity. After the Great War depleted Cybertron's Energon reserves, the Ark — Optimus Prime's ship — was struck by the Nemesis (Decepticon ship) and crashed on Earth 4 million years ago. Both factions slept until 1984, when a volcano awakened them. What was supposed to be a resupply mission turned into a 40-year war on an unknown planet. 🤝 Special Teams — Combiners & Wreckers
When the Autobots combine their forces, they create indestructible titans.
The Autobots have developed their own Combiner technology — fewer in number than the Decepticons, but just as formidable. These teams merge to form giants whose collective power surpasses that of each individual member. To understand everything about this mechanism: How Combiners work.
✈️ Aerialbots → Superion
The Autobots' answer to Starscream's Seekers. Five fighter jets that merge into Superion, the guardian of the skies. Silverbolt is their leader despite his legendary fear of heights. See Superion →
🚒 Protectobots → Defensor
The first Autobot Combiners designed exclusively to save civilian lives. Their combined form Defensor is the most pacifist Combiner — but by no means the least powerful. See Defensor →
🔬 Technobots → Computron
The brainy Combiner. Computron can analyze any situation and calculate the optimal solution in milliseconds. Artificial war intelligence in its purest form. See Computron →
💀 The Wreckers — The Secret Unit
Not a Combiner, but the most feared elite unit of the Autobots. Springer, Roadbuster, Topspin, Leadfoot — those sent in when all other options have failed. Wreckers File →

🎨 Generation 1 (1984–1987) — The Foundation
The original G1 laid the groundwork for everything that followed. The Autobots of this era have clearly defined personalities and alt-modes directly inspired by 1980s American cars: Optimus Prime is a Peterbilt semi-truck, Ironhide is a Nissan van, Jazz is a Porsche 935. This real-world rooted choice gave the franchise its unique flavor — extraterrestrial robots blending into our daily lives. For the most iconic episodes: Top 10 Cult G1 Episodes.
🦁 Beast Wars (1996–1999) — The Maximal Heirs
Millions of years in the future, the descendants of the Autobots are called the Maximals. Their alt-modes are animals — Optimus Primal transforms into a gorilla, Cheetor into a cheetah, Rhinox into a rhinoceros. This series revolutionized the lore by explicitly linking the two franchises: the Maximals find the original Autobots sleeping on prehistoric Earth, creating a fascinating time loop. 🔵 Transformers Prime (2010–2013) — The Dark Version
Transformers Prime is the best-written animated series in the entire franchise according to many adult fans. The Autobots are reduced to a small isolated group on Earth — Optimus, Bumblebee, Arcee, Bulkhead, Ratchet, and Smokescreen — which forces a much deeper characterization than in G1. Each character is developed, each relationship matters. The death of some Autobots is treated with a gravity that will mark the audience. 📚 IDW Comics (2005–2018) — The Era of Moral Complexity
IDW Publishing comics brought a dimension that neither cartoons nor movies had dared to explore: the Autobots sometimes do terrible things. Ultra Magnus becomes a borderline vigilante. Optimus Prime questions his legitimacy to govern. Some Autobots wonder if the war hasn't turned them into monsters. It's this moral complexity that attracted a new generation of adult fans to the franchise. The character of Drift — a former Decepticon turned Autobot — embodies all this nuance by himself.
